Output 84eed8b811694b935c1b4ada88cc80e8fcb568f6eecba22c932e8c3961246c07:1

value
346951
script pubkey
OP_0 OP_PUSHBYTES_20 02743311091e5fb84f57cf12107bdfbb323bb57a
address
bc1qqf6rxygfre0msn6heufpq77lhverhdt6r579lh
transaction
84eed8b811694b935c1b4ada88cc80e8fcb568f6eecba22c932e8c3961246c07